Find the best Rector rule to solve your problem. Searching through 671 rules.
Found 2 rules:
Change app() func calls to facade calls
class SomeClass
{
public function run()
{
- return app('translator')->trans('value');
+ return \Illuminate\Support\Facades\App::make('translator')->trans('value');
}
}
Change static validate() method to $request->validate()
use Illuminate\Http\Request;
class SomeClass
{
- public function store()
+ public function store(\Illuminate\Http\Request $request)
{
- $validatedData = Request::validate(['some_attribute' => 'required']);
+ $validatedData = $request->validate(['some_attribute' => 'required']);
}
}